There are actually 2 versions of the Jakks paddle. I see the one player version fairly routinely in thrift stores, but have only seen the 2 player one once (when I bought mine).

I absolutely love the Jakks paddles! Great recreation. My only complaint other than lack of titles is that the winning "beep" in Arcade Pong is a little too long for my taste. I'm really nit-picking but compared to how the original hardware made a scoring quick beep, the Jakks seem to take forever. Trust me, this is about the only complaint there is with these.
